Let's face it...we're not perfect, but thank God that we're saved by grace through faith. We might never be perfect until the day we step into glory, but we are striving for perfection. God is never tripped up or shocked when we sin, no matter how big it is. So when you make one, don't run from Him. Run to Him! He's not blind to the fact that you are frail in your own ways. He understands and He cares. So get up and go on. God doesn't have a problem with sin...we do!! He has already taken care of sin. And now He wants to have an awesome relationship with you and help you move closer to Him. There's a difference between falling in the mud and laying in it. Stay close to Him and you will find yourself becoming like Him. Don't get caught up in getting it right yourself, but be caught up in getting to know Him and loving on Him and giving Him praise no matter what kind of position you are in. God is doing the work and you are simply resting in it. And as you trust in Him, He will shape you and mold you into His image. To be a vessel for Him to use in these last days. Never before have we seen such a tremendous amount of hurting and lost souls.But along with the needs comes the provision: not from this world, but from the Lord Jesus Christ. He meets our needs according to His riches in glory. He is the same yesterday, today, and forever. Sick in the body? You can be healed! In bondage? You can be set free! Hungry and thirsty? You can be filled! It's not a question of whether or not God is willing. It is a question of whether or not we can believe, and whether or not we are willing to receive. God is more willing to give us than we are willing to ask. All things are possible to him who dares to believe. To believe is to take God at His Word simply because He said it. Our God is able to do exceedingly and abundantly far above all that we could ever ask or think. This means that when we ask much...He says "more". When we think big...He says "bigger"! Our God is a big God and He will not withold anything that is good from us (those who loves Him). We would love to hear from you. We appreciate your prayers and support. Remember...God is in control!!! Be blessed. In Christian Love, Minh Chau. MY TESTIMONY: My name is Minh Chau. I'm 17 yrs old. I'm a senior in high school. The Lord saved me during my sophomore year in high school. I used smoke a lot of weed and hustle crack on the streets. I hung out with the 202 Mob, a local gang. I remembered that sold some fake crack to a crackhead one day. And being so afraid for my life, I hid in the house for a little while. During that break from the streets, I went to church with one of my friends. The pastor there gave an altar call all the youth to come up and pray and tarry to be filled with the Holy Ghost. I didn't know what it was, but I was a youth so I decided not to be left out and went up anyway. Afterwards, he wanted the youth to testify (one by one) what the Lord did for them that day. I got up and said hesitantly "Today...the Lord saved me." And as soon as I said "saved", something came over me and I began to cry for absolutely no reason. Tears would flow like a river. It was the strangest yet the most wonderful thing that has ever happened to me. Better than everything that I had encounter in my life. And from that moment on, my life was completely changed. The Holy Spirit got a hold of me and is working in me today, moving me closer to my Lord Jesus. Now, I am anointed with the power of the Holy Ghost by Jesus Christ and chosen to be a worldwide evangelist, filled with the gifts of the Spirit. If He could do it for me, He can do it for you. HOW CAN I BE SAVED? Read Romans 10:9-11. 1. Confess that you are a sinner and repent. 2. Believe in your heart and proclaim that Jesus Christ died on the cross for your sins, and on the third day rose from the dead,and then ascended into the heavens and is now sitting at the right hand of God. 3. Pray and invite Jesus into your heart and into your life. That He would be the Lord of your life. 4. Confess to others that Jesus is Lord of your life. That you are saved by Him, by His grace, and by His blood. 5. Begin to pray to Him daily. He loves to hear from you. And begin to read the Bible and get to know Him. The more time you spend with Him, the more you will fall in love with Him. Remember, He will never leave you nor forsake you no matter what you do. Just turn to Him, rely on Him, stay close to Him, and He will see you through. |
